Four boys drown while trying to retrieve football in Kulim

KULIM, Sept 15 - Four boys died after allegedly falling into a drain while attempting to retrieve a football at Taman Desa Kayangan, Sungai Karangan, yesterday evening.

Kulim police chief Supt Syamsul Sinring said two of the victims died at the scene, while the other two succumbed to their injuries while being taken to Kulim Hospital.

He identified the victims as Muhammad Zafril Arsyad Muhamad Azrin, 12; Muhammad Iman Nuruddin Khairol Anuar, 10; and step-siblings Muhamad Aeril Aziz Muhamad Zafis, 12, and Muhammad Arif Naufan Abdullah, eight.

“Police received a call from a member of the public at 7.45 pm yesterday reporting that four victims had drowned in a retention pond at Taman Desa Kayangan.

“Ambulance personnel confirmed that two victims died at the scene, while the other two passed away while being transported to Kulim Hospital,” he said in a statement today.

Syamsul said all four victims lived near Taman Desa Kayangan.

He said interviews with the victims’ mothers revealed that the boys had left home to play football before the ball reportedly fell into a drain at the location.

“The victims are believed to have attempted to retrieve the ball before falling into the drain,” he said.

He added that there were no witnesses to the incident. The drain was estimated to be about 10 feet deep and six feet wide.

The bodies were taken to Sultanah Bahiyah Hospital (HSB) in Alor Setar last night for post-mortem examinations.
